Risk Program Administrators LLC Reports Data Incident to Nebraska AG
Risk Program Administrators LLC filed a data breach report with the Nebraska Attorney General on July 23, 2026, confirming a security incident. The company stated that personal information was compromised, but specific details about the types of data or affected individuals were not disclosed in the initial filing. Risk Program Administrators LLC reported a data security incident to the Nebraska Attorney General on July 23, 2026. The filing indicates the company is investigating the full scope of this breach after unauthorized activity was detected within its digital environment.
While the company confirmed that personal information was compromised, the official report did not specify the exact categories of data involved. The number of people affected by this incident was also not disclosed in the public filing.

What to do if you were affected
These general steps can help limit the risk of identity theft and fraud after any data breach.
Stay alert to targeted scams
Be cautious of calls, texts, or emails that reference this breach. Legitimate organizations won't ask you to confirm sensitive details through an unsolicited message.
Keep your notification letter
Save the notice you received. It documents that your information was involved and is often needed to enroll in any credit monitoring offered or to join a related legal claim.
